In his remarks at the central bank’s annual symposium in Jackson Hole, Wyoming, Warsh said, “While this summer’s PCE and CPI readings were better than expected, they do not tell me that underlying trends have meaningfully improved.”

He also said, “We must be confident that underlying inflation is moving to our objective, clearly and at sufficient speed. Otherwise, we have work to do. That’s our job ... our mandate ... and our charge to keep.”

Fed Chair Kevin Warsh also warned that "inflation is running above our 2% target" and that "the Fed's predominant focus right now should be on prices"

Warsh did not explicitly say whether the Fed should raise its benchmark interest rate to force inflation down to its 2% annual target after more than 5 years of above-target price increases.

Walmart Sales Drop: American Consumer Under Pressure

Walmart’s earnings report told us something about the middle-market American consumer: they are making trade-offs at the register. Those trade-offs showed up in Walmart’s revenue, and the company came in below what most investors expected on both revenue and profit for the quarter.

We read this as one data point rather than a change in direction. It is worth noting, not worth repositioning a portfolio over. We will keep watching as the situation develops.

The national debt crossed $40 trillion this week, and it took just four and a half years to add the last $10 trillion of it. Meanwhile, the Fed and the Treasury spent the week moving in opposite directions on bond rates... One willing to let them rise to bring inflation down, the other buying bonds to push rates lower.
